I know that my question is not strictly R-related, but... Is there any good strategy (preferably already implemented in R) for estimating interaction radii of a MultiStrauss model?
I have been working with function profilepl in spatstat, but I frequently have to evaluate I too many combinations of interaction radii (1000's) and not even then I am sure that I get the right answer, because either I have likelihood maxima that are very narrow (easy to miss; it is one of the cases that I fave faced), or two local maxima with a large separation among them, leading to very different answers (from inhibition to gamma parameters higher than one, which if I have properly understood, are not "desirable") or changing the evaluation grid slightly I get different (or very different) answers.
Should I just resign, take a deep breath and evaluate a grid of interaction radii of 10,000's?
